MVB Nets a Pair of AVCA All-Americans
May 01, 2017 | Men's Volleyball
Junior outside hitter Jake Arnitz and senior middle blocker Mitch Stahl were selected to the 27th annualย American Volleyball Coaches Association (AVCA) Division I-II Men's All-America teams announced on Monday. ย Arnitz repeated as a second-team performer, while Stahl was named to the honorable mention team. The awards will be presented at the NCAA Men's Volleyball Championship Banquet on the campus of The Ohio State University, site of the Men's Volleyball Championship, on Wednesday, May 3.
Arnitz, a 2017 first-team All-Mountain Pacific Sports Federation (MPSF) selection,ย led the Bruins with a 3.51 kills per set mark this season. He finished the season ranked sixth on the all-time school list for total attacks with 1,757 and ninth on the all-time lists for kills (818) and total points scored (958.5). Arnitz was named the MPSF/Molten Player of the Week for his outstanding performance in wins at USC and Cal Baptist when he hit .450 for the pair of matches with a total of 33 kills, including a career-high tying 21 kills versus the Lancers. Last season, heย also earned second-team AVCA All-America honors while helping lead the Bruins to the NCAA Championship Tournament.
Stahl, also a 2017 first-team All-MPSFย pick, led the Bruins in blocking (83 total blocks) and aces (42) this season. He ranked seventh in the nation in ace average per set and his total of 42 service aces was the ninth-best single-season total in school rally scoring era history. Stahl established a new school mark with his 0.55 aces per set average to move past Mark Williams' old school record of 0.51 set in 2001. He completed his career second on the all-time aces list at the school (129) and was third all-time in both block assists (322) and total blocks (345). He was a second-team AVCA All-America in 2016.
